Adventure park activities can offer several benefits for school groups. These activities are not only fun and exciting but also provide valuable learning opportunities and personal development experiences. Here are some of the benefits of adventure park activities for school groups:
 

Physical Fitness: Adventure park activities often involve physical challenges such as climbing, zip-lining, and hiking. Engaging in these activities helps students improve their physical fitness, strength, and coordination.

Teamwork and Collaboration: Many adventure park activities require participants to work together to solve problems and complete tasks. This promotes teamwork, communication, and collaboration among school group members.

Confidence Building: Overcoming obstacles and taking on challenges in an adventure park can boost students' self-confidence and self-esteem. They gain a sense of accomplishment when they successfully complete a challenging task.

Problem Solving: Adventure activities often present participants with puzzles and obstacles that require creative problem-solving. Students can develop their critical thinking and decision-making skills while tackling these challenges.

Risk Management: Adventure park activities provide a controlled environment for students to learn about risk management. They can assess risks, make informed decisions, and understand the importance of safety precautions.

Environmental Awareness: Many adventure parks are set in natural environments, allowing students to connect with nature and gain a greater appreciation for the outdoors. This can foster a sense of environmental responsibility and conservation awareness

Overcoming Fear: Conquering fears is a common experience in adventure park activities. Facing and overcoming fears can be a powerful personal growth experience for students, helping them build resilience and courage.

Leadership Development: Some adventure park activities may involve leadership roles or decision-making responsibilities. This provides opportunities for students to develop leadership skills and take on leadership roles within their school group.

9. Experiential Learning: Adventure park activities offer hands-on, experiential learning opportunities that can complement classroom education. Students can apply concepts learned in the classroom to real-life situations.

10. Fun and Enjoyment: Perhaps most importantly, adventure park activities are a lot of fun! They offer an exciting break from the routine of school and can be a memorable and enjoyable experience for students.

Overall, adventure park activities for school groups can provide a well-rounded educational experience that combines physical fitness, personal development, teamwork, and environmental awareness with a healthy dose of excitement and fun.
